Admission to the MBA program at the college requires an entrance test with subsequent merit-based assessment, group discussion, and personal interview. The faculty, with extensive corporate experience, use real-life examples to teach. The two-year course fee is approximately 7.85 Lacs, with available financial aid through scholarships and bank loans. Despite the high fee, placement statistics are strong, with about 90% of students securing jobs. Over 200 companies, including Amazon and Tata, recruit from campus, offering packages ranging from 3 LPA to 25 LPA, with median and average salaries between 6 to 7.5 LPA.
Placement eligibility begins in the 3rd semester, and internships in fields like market research and sales are available, although some lack stipends. The college hosts over 1,000 students per batch, has excellent infrastructure, and charges fees between 600,000 to 950,000 for the program, inclusive of all expenses, with annual fee increases of 9-10%.
